About Court of Strangers
Court of Strangers is a web-based forum that frames interpersonal conflicts and societal debates as cases people can submit, judge, and analyze. Users vote before seeing others' opinions (blind voting) to capture independent judgments, then reveal aggregated verdicts, breakdowns, and community insights. Supports submitting cases, anonymous/blind polling, verdict summaries, and exploration of reasoning and trends to surface collective judgement and perspectives.
Key Features
- Submit interpersonal or societal cases for community judgment
- Blind voting (vote before seeing others) to capture independent opinions
- Aggregated verdicts and visualized insights explaining community reasoning
- Explore case details, comments, and trends across verdicts
Who is this for?
People seeking community input on disputes and debates, moderators, journalists, researchers, and anyone interested in crowdsourced judgements.
